The synthesis of 1-monosubstituted 1,2,3-triazoles was achieved
using azides and propiolic acid by copper-catalyzed click cycloaddition/decarboxylation,
which was easily carried out in N,N-dimethylformamide at room temperature
or 60 ˚C with yields ranging from moderate to excellent.
The reaction conditions were found to be successful for aryl and
vinyl azide reactants, including analogues with various functionalities.
